Wind pollinated flowers are
A
Small, producing nectar and dry pollen
B
Small, brightly coloured, producing large number of pollen grains
C
Small, producing large number of dry pollen grains
D
Large, producing abundant nectar and pollen
Correct Answer
Option C
Detailed Explanation
Colourless, odourless and nectarless flowers in anemophily.
